Output 384525fa69b48c15f9d691a99683c6afb39e823f51b51372fc830eaae808671c:0

value
122037343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ecc7fe367b08b3443486a2297518eadaa50c06d8 OP_EQUALVERIFY OP_CHECKSIG
address
1Naz42miiEfxt9aCUzT7QpwuLbCeZg4EZC
transaction
384525fa69b48c15f9d691a99683c6afb39e823f51b51372fc830eaae808671c
spent
true